CHARLOTTE, N.C. (WBTV) – The man accused of fatally stabbing a Ukrainian refugee on a Charlotte light rail back in August is due in federal court on Thursday.
Decarlos Brown Jr., who was indicted by a grand jury in October for violence against a railroad carrier and mass transportation system resulting in death, will make his first appearance in federal court on Thursday, Dec. 11.
Brown is accused of stabbing 23-year-old Iryna Zarutska on a Charlotte light rail at the end of August…
